Capacity note for the Fennelgrid sidecar review. Aggregation window widened to cut emit rate; per-pod memory ceiling holds at current cardinality (~12k series). CPU flat. Risk: buffer overflow if a tenant spikes labels — mitigated by the drop policy. No node-pool changes needed for the Caldermoor cluster this quarter. Review the flush and buffer settings before merge. Constants under review are below.

limits module of yafop-hahag:
QUOTAS = {
    "tamwyn": 652,
    "prawyn": 731,
}

## Formula sandbox tuning

User-supplied formulas in Gridmoor execute inside a restricted interpreter with hard ceilings on time, memory, and call depth. Reviewers should confirm any change to these ceilings is justified in the PR description, since raising them widens the abuse surface. Defaults were chosen from production traces. The current limits are as follows.

limits module of tafog-fawip:
WEIGHTS = {
    "julix": 57,
    "lamys": 992,
    "kasvan": 209,
    "quenok": 750,
    "alddor": 259,
    "oliath": 1009,
    "wenix": 815,
}

# Break-Glass: Catalog Cache Invalidation

Scope: the Pinrow product catalog at Veldstone Retail. If stale prices persist after a purge and the Hollowmere invalidation queue is wedged, use break-glass to flush the edge tier directly. Contractors: get verbal sign-off from the catalog lead first. Steps: open the Hollowmere admin shell, select emergency-flush, confirm the tenant, and run it once — repeated flushes thrash the origin. Access is logged and expires after 20 minutes. Unseal the admin shell with the passphrase below.

recovery phrase for kahop-tajog: istix-casvan

## Service Accounts — Snapshot Testing

The Glimmerline UI team runs snapshot tests for all shared components through the `snapcheck-bot` service account. This account has read-only access to the Prismloft render farm and uploads baseline images to the Verdant bucket nightly. Per last week's sync, rotation now happens quarterly rather than annually. For local runs against the snapshot service, authenticate with the key below.

gateway credential: kto23_LX9A4ys6i4nzHtpOLNLodKK